Q: Is 55,316,617 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 55,316,617 is a composite number.

Why is 55,316,617 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 55,316,617 can be evenly divided by 1 31 467 3,821 14,477 118,451 1,784,407 and 55,316,617, with no remainder.

Since 55,316,617 cannot be divided by just 1 and 55,316,617, it is a composite number.
